activemq-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From franz1981 <>
Subject [GitHub] activemq-artemis issue #1777: ARTEMIS-1606 - Change AddressInfo RoutingType ...
Date Thu, 18 Jan 2018 10:31:25 GMT
Github user franz1981 commented on the issue:
    These are the flamegraph of a couple of profiled tests, one on master:
    Where the violet bars are the `AddressInfo::new` and the `AddressInfo::getRoutingType`
(+ iterator) while with this PR:
    There isn't anymore any cost associated with `AddressInfo`: for me is a thumbs up!
    Althouh it seems negligible (at a first look) the impact of this change has changed the
garbage produced and the CPU time required to call `doSend`: indeed the latencies are better
    Well done :100: 


View raw message